“Immortal Songs” Goes Off-Air For The First Time In 6 Years As Result Of KBS Strike

The popular music variety program “Immortal Songs” will not be airing this week as a result of the ongoing strike at KBS.

On November 25, the KBS variety department reported that the planned episode of “Immortal Songs” this week was canceled. Instead, they will be airing a rerun of the October special “Introducing My Friend.”

This is the first time in six years that “Immortal Songs 2” has gone off-air. As a result of the KBS strike, which began in September, several variety shows have met with various degrees of canceling, such as “2 Days & 1 Night,” “The Return of Superman,” and “Happy Together,” but “Immortal Songs” had not been affected until now.

When the strike began, “Immortal Songs” continued their basic filming with head PDs stepping in to direct, but the show finally decided to take a hiatus due to lack of personnel. Recently the situation regarding the KBS strike has become more severe after 11 variety department heads and team leaders handed in their resignations on November 21.

Although other shows like “Gag Concert” and “The Unit” have continued to air, KBS’s end-of-year awards ceremonies have also been thrown into doubt as a result of the strike.
